As for where its breaking... I'll post pictures tomorrow of that, but its the flange where it mounts to the T-Case... it's just busting the "loops" over the U-Joint caps. I've broken 3 of them this way.

Ran the same #7 SW - RPM High, Timing 2, RP 4, Shift Limiter Off, TQ Management was on 2 this time though instead of 4.
Seems there was alot less smoke on spool up this time, but I still didn't get the boost I was wanting too before leaving... Was aiming for 15ish.
Boost was right at 10 PSI when the shaft broke... Shaft broke just as the truck brakes were having a hell of a time (loosing that battle as you can see) holding the truck back. Usually once this charger gets to about 12-14PSI she lights right on up to 40PSI quickly, so I was JUST about ready to let off the brakes.
I'm starting to wonder if my converter isn't too tight, it stalls high enough in HIGH range to get ANY amount of boost I want and still hold it back with the brakes, but in LOW range... it just keeps wanting to push through.
